A utility client in Houston has a need for a LogicMonitor-focused Network Monitoring Specialist to support the configuration, implementation, and ongoing tuning of the LogicMonitor platform. This... role will help ensure accurate monitoring, alerting, and escalation for activity associated with Smart Grid, telecommunications MPLS, corporate network infrastructure, and dedicated circuits. This person will be monitoring logic, alert accuracy, alert translation, and escalation workflow within LogicMonitor. They will also be responsible for reviewing and analyzing alerts to determine severity and escalation needs (e.g., validating whether an alert is Minor vs. Critical) and translate technical alert data into plain-English alarm descriptions to improve clarity and response alignment. This role will build and maintain alert rules and device-specific monitoring standards (e.g., rules for device types such as TVs or other asset classes). This person will Perform MIB translations: convert OID/MIB-based alert messages into recognizable, actionable language, and supporting monitoring tied to SNMP/MIB polling and help determine which items warrant escalation. They will conduct ?alert matching? to ensure alerts visible in existing monitoring tools (ex: OpenText Network Node Manager) are also accurately visible and aligned in LogicMonitor. A well-known Government supporting company is seeking a Pricing Analyst to sit remotely to support various Space Force customers. This Pricing Analyst role supports Space Systems Command and focuses... on pricing and evaluating large, high dollar DoD proposals, often $500M+ in size. The position handles cost and price analysis, develops Excel based pricing models, and prepares key documents like Price Negotiation Memorandums, clearance briefings, and evaluation write ups. The work spans both sole source and competitive efforts and covers areas such as profit and fee analysis, cost realism, parametric estimating, and performance based payments.
